The Assistant General Manager provides vital support to the General Manager in leading the marketing and operations functions of the Truck Service business unit.

In this role, you can expect to:

  • Be the leader and inspire your team to meet and exceed company performance standards and maximize the potential of the Truck Service department (i.e. fast and friendly customer service, good product knowledge, up-beat atmosphere, professional language, etc.)
  • Embody a professional demeanor and a high level of character, honesty and integrity in conducting the business affairs. Inspire all team members to do the same
  • Develop a trusting atmosphere that is conducive to receiving feedback from team members and guests; coach, discipline, and/or terminate the staff according to company policy
  • Recruit, hire, train and retain high-quality employees according to company guidelines and create a culture where employees feel respected and recognized for their achievements.
  • Creatively solve problems and develop robust solutions
  • Conduct visual inspections to ensure that all products and services are available
  • Maintain a pleasant and welcome appearance to our customers. (i.e. restrooms, showers, signage, lighting, parking lot condition, air conditioning, heating, snow removal…etc.)
  • Help achieve financial objectives through effective management of people, product, service and facility processes, including a focus on the revenue and profit components
  • Adhere to safety standard, comply with standards of operation and follow company guidelines on vendor relationships
